About this app

I wrote this app as a homage to my little daughter. I drew the animals, recorded myself their sounds and did a version of the music that she likes the most. It's a simple but funny memory card game where the kid can find the pairs in four levels of difficulty. I hope you all like it.

Developed for kids between 1 to 3 years old.
